Biography & Background: JFL42 began in 2012 as a Toronto-friendly, pass-based extension of the Just For Laughs brand, designed to spotlight bold, diverse comedians in a flexible, city-wide format. The festival has historically utilized a multi-venue model, rotating through prominent Toronto stages and smaller clubs to create a dynamic, community-focused experience. Its programming has included a blend of headliners and rising stars, reflecting the broader Just For Laughs approach while tailoring to Toronto’s vibrant arts scene.
Upcoming Tour & Events: The 2025 programming includes confirmed performances such as Maria Bamford at the Bluma Appel Theatre in Toronto on September 27, 2025.
